Journal ArticleDOI

Observation of electroweak production of same-sign W boson pairs in the two jet and two same-sign lepton final state in proton-proton collisions at s√= 13 TeV

Albert M. Sirunyan, +2275 more
TL;DR: The first observation of electroweak production of same-sign W boson pairs in proton-proton collisions was reported in this article, where the data sample corresponds to an integrated luminosity of 359 fb^(−1) collected at a center-of-mass energy of 13 TeV with the CMS detector at the LHC Events are selected by requiring exactly two leptons (electrons or muons) of the same charge, moderate missing transverse momentum, and two jets with a large rapidity separation and a large dijet mass.

Journal ArticleDOI

Search for additional neutral MSSM Higgs bosons in the τ τ final state in proton-proton collisions at √s=13 TeV

Albert M. Sirunyan, +2390 more
TL;DR: In this paper, a search for additional neutral Higgs bosons in the τ τ final state in proton-proton collisions at the LHC was performed in the context of the minimal supersymmetric extension of the standard model (MSSM), using the data collected with the CMS detector in 2016 at a center-of-mass energy of 13 TeV, corresponding to an integrated luminosity of 35.9 fb−1.
Journal ArticleDOI

Search for massive resonances decaying into pairs of boosted bosons in semi-leptonic final states at s = 8 TeV

Vardan Khachatryan, +2189 more
TL;DR: In this article, a search for new resonances decaying to WW, ZZ, or WZ is presented, based on data corresponding to an integrated luminosity of 19.7 fb^(−1) recorded in proton-proton collisions at √s = 8 TeV.
